Whom I Follow and Why

I don’t automatically follow everyone who follows me. Why? I limit the number of people I follow so I can actually talk with and listen to my followers.

I have two general rules I use to decide whom to follow.

  • People in my geographic community (they are part of my real life business and personal interactions).
  • People who talk about things that I’m interested in (outside of business) that inspire me to be the person I want to be.

I run into many fascinating people because they follow me on Twitter, people who are making very interesting contributions to the community. Don’t take it personally if I don’t follow you back. But don’t be surprised if you get an occasional reply or direct message from me, either.

What I Tweet

I write different tweets for each audience segment I follow. But generally, you can expect me to tweet about:

  • Interesting articles I find in newspapers, magazines, blogs, and websites.
  • Announcements of my new blog posts.
  • News about writing and social media use.
  • Inspirational quotes.
  • Slice of my life tweets.

I try to maintain the following tweet breakout:

  • 60% content including retweets.
  • 30% replies.
  • 10% what I’m doing now.

Some days I stray from this, but over a week, this is the breakout you can expect to see. If you have any questions about my contribution to the conversation, just review my archives.
